(3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ane: A Key Ingredient in the Chemical Industry

(3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ane, also known as γ-chloropropyltriethoxysilane, is a chemical compound that belongs to the organosilicon family. This colorless liquid is widely used in the chemical industry as a coupling agent, surface modifier, and adhesion promoter. Chemical Properties

The molecular formula of (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is C9H21ClO3Si, and its molecular weight is 238.81 g/mol. This compound has a boiling point of 212-213°C and a flashpoint of 82°C. It is soluble in organic solvents such as ethanol, toluene, and chloroform but insoluble in water. (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is a reactive compound that can hydrolyze in the presence of moisture to form silanols and ethyl alcohol.

Applications

(3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ane has a wide range of applications in various industries, including:

1. Coatings and Adhesives: In the coatings and adhesives industry, (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is used as a coupling agent to improve the bonding strength between organic and inorganic materials. It can also be used as a surface modifier to enhance the hydrophobicity and chemical resistance of coatings and adhesives.

2. Rubber and Plastics: (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is widely used in the rubber and plastics industry as a coupling agent and adhesion promoter. It can improve the mechanical properties, such as tensile strength and tear resistance, of rubber and plastic compounds.

3. Glass Fiber: (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is used in the glass fiber industry as a sizing agent to enhance the adhesion between glass fibers and resin matrices. It can also improve the mechanical properties and water resistance of glass fiber-reinforced composites.

4. Pharmaceuticals: (3-Chloropropyl)triethoxysilane is used as a reagent in the synthesis of various pharmaceutical compounds. It can also be used as a surface modifier to improve the bioavailability and stability of drug molecules.
